WASHINGTON, April 1. /TASS/. Republican lawmakers form the US House Judiciary Committee initiated a probe against Twitter and Facebook (outlawed in Russia, owned by Meta, deemed extremist organization in Russia). The investigation was initiated over the decision made by the websites’ owners in 2020 to censor the dissemination of media publications regarding messages of Hunter Biden - son of then-presidential candidate Joe Biden.

"Judiciary Republicans launch investigation into Twitter and Facebook following new reports on Hunter Biden’s laptop," the lawmakers said in their Twitter account.

Prior to the 2020 elections, The New York Post published a material based on Hunter Biden’s confidential correspondence; according to the media, the correspondence, allegedly obtained from Hunter Biden’s laptop, indicated that he sought to use his father’s office in his own business interests. Then-presidential candidate Joe Biden claimed that Russia was involved in the dissemination of this information. Twitter and Facebook made a decision at the time to suppress the dissemination of this information under various pretexts.

In March, the New York Times published another article saying that at least some correspondence has been found genuine by the federal investigators.
